The Los Angeles Chargers hosted a women in sports day and the coaching staff went all in on annual the celebration.

Head coach Jim Harbaugh, offensive coordinator Mike McDaniel and defensive coordinator Chris O’Leary all sported Nike t-shirts that included the message: “EVERYONE WATCHES WOMEN’S SPORTS.”
Chargers head coach Jim Harbaugh wore a special-themed shirt for the team’s Women in Sports Day. X/@LA ChargersThe team’s event at The Bolt featured collaboration from Togethxr, UCLA, the Los Angeles Sparks Sparks, and Angel City F.C. Fans that attended Sunday’s practice received posters, stickers and friendship bracelets from Togethxr, a media and commerce company focused on women’s sports, lifestyle, and culture.
There was also “The Future Is Female Panel” along with player interactions with girls’ youth flag football players and a women’s flag football coaching clinic.

Unfortunately, we live in a cynical world where trolls can take to social media. Sunday was another example, with an X user photoshopping the shirt worn by offensive coordinator Mike McDaniel to say, “Nobody Watches Women’s Sports,” a post that has more than 1.5 million views.
Thankfully, most people saw the post for what it was, a poor attempt to disrupt what was a great day of practice for the Chargers and women’s sports.
